The smart thermostat is where you start. I resisted this for years because I thought it was unnecessary, but I finally installed one last winter and it has cut my heating bill by almost 40 percent. It learns your schedule, adjusts automatically, and honestly feels like having a tiny robot managing your comfort. This one pays for itself quickly.

Then there is the smart lighting situation, which I was skeptical about until I actually lived with it. I do not need my lights to change colors for parties or whatever. What I need is to dim them from bed, turn them on before I get home, and never wonder if I left the bathroom light on. That is exactly what these do. Simple. Effective. Life-changing in the most unsexy way possible.

Smart speakers are worth the investment. I use mine for timers while cooking, weather updates, and playing music without touching my phone. It is not magic. But it makes daily tasks smoother. The sound quality is solid. And yes, I worried about privacy at first—still do sometimes—but I use mine enough that I made peace with it.
